What is Cryptocurrency Mining and How Does It Work?

Summary:Learn about cryptocurrency mining, the process of verifying transactions on a blockchain network and creating new units of digital currency. Discover the benefits, challenges, and potential risks of mining.

Cryptocurrency mining is the process of verifying transactions on a blockchain network and adding them to the public ledger. It involves using powerful computers to solve complex mathematical equations, which in turn creates new units of the digital currency. The Basics of Cryptocurrency Mining

The concept of cryptocurrency mining is closely linked to the blockchain technology that underpins it. Blockchains are decentralized digital ledgers that record transactions in a secure and transparent manner. To maintain the integrity of the blockchain, miners compete to solve complex mathematical puzzles, which are designed to be difficult and time-consuming.

Once a miner solves a puzzle, they add a new block to the chain and receive a reward in the form of newly-minted digital tokens. This process is known as proof-of-work (PoW) mining and is used by many popular c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in and Ethereum.

Benefits of Cryptocurrency Mining

Cryptocurrency mining has several benefits. Firstly, it incentivizes miners to contribute their computational power to the network, which helps to secure the blockchain and prevent fraud. Secondly, it enables the creation of new units of the cryptocurrency, which can be used to reward miners and fund the development of the network.

Another benefit of mining is that it allows for thedecentralizationof the network. Since anyone with a computer and internet connection can participate in mining, it reduces the concentration of power among a few large players. This creates a more democratic and transparent system that is resistant to censorship and control by governments or other centralized entities.

Challenges and Risks of Cryptocurrency Mining

While cryptocurrency mining has many benefits, it is not without its challenges and risks. One of the biggest challenges is the high cost of hardware and electricity required to mine effectively. Mining rigs can cost thousands of dollars and consume vast amounts of energy, making it difficult for small-scale miners to compete with larger players.

Another challenge is the environmental impact of mining. The energy consumption required for mining has been criticized for its contribution to global carbon emissions. However, some cryptocurrencies are working on developing more sustainable mining methods, such as proof-of-stake (PoS) mining, which requires less energy.

In addition to these challenges, there are also risks associated with mining, such as the volatility of the cryptocurrency market. Since the value of cryptocurrencies can fluctuate wildly, miners may find that their rewards are worth significantly less than they expected. There is also the risk of hacking and theft, as miners need to store their digital tokens in wallets that are vulnerable to cyber attacks.
